diff options
author | Stefan Tauner <stefan.tauner@alumni.tuwien.ac.at> | 2011-06-26 17:38:17 +0000 |
---|---|---|
committer | Stefan Tauner <stefan.tauner@alumni.tuwien.ac.at> | 2011-06-26 17:38:17 +0000 |
commit | f1e478027fa603760381edebc4575348ec980092 (patch) | |
tree | faac95f42ab982a40eaf615ce0310fdf1083721f /flash.h | |
parent | 562440bfcbf1c244e7e70a0c33b266b64ba420f3 (diff) | |
download | flashrom-f1e478027fa603760381edebc4575348ec980092.zip flashrom-f1e478027fa603760381edebc4575348ec980092.tar.gz |
Constify (a few) parameters in flashrom.c where possible
Corresponding to flashrom svn r1354.
Signed-off-by: Stefan Tauner <stefan.tauner@alumni.tuwien.ac.at>
Acked-by: Carl-Daniel Hailfinger <c-d.hailfinger.devel.2006@gmx.net>
Diffstat (limited to 'flash.h')
-rw-r--r-- | flash.h | 12 |
1 files changed, 6 insertions, 6 deletions
@@ -205,21 +205,21 @@ void map_flash_registers(struct flashchip *flash); int read_memmapped(struct flashchip *flash, uint8_t *buf, int start, int len); int erase_flash(struct flashchip *flash); int probe_flash(int startchip, struct flashchip *fill_flash, int force); -int read_flash_to_file(struct flashchip *flash, char *filename); +int read_flash_to_file(struct flashchip *flash, const char *filename); int min(int a, int b); int max(int a, int b); void tolower_string(char *str); -char *extract_param(char **haystack, char *needle, char *delim); -int verify_range(struct flashchip *flash, uint8_t *cmpbuf, int start, int len, char *message); +char *extract_param(char **haystack, const char *needle, const char *delim); +int verify_range(struct flashchip *flash, uint8_t *cmpbuf, int start, int len, const char *message); int need_erase(uint8_t *have, uint8_t *want, int len, enum write_granularity gran); char *strcat_realloc(char *dest, const char *src); void print_version(void); void print_banner(void); void list_programmers_linebreak(int startcol, int cols, int paren); int selfcheck(void); -int doit(struct flashchip *flash, int force, char *filename, int read_it, int write_it, int erase_it, int verify_it); -int read_buf_from_file(unsigned char *buf, unsigned long size, char *filename); -int write_buf_to_file(unsigned char *buf, unsigned long size, char *filename); +int doit(struct flashchip *flash, int force, const char *filename, int read_it, int write_it, int erase_it, int verify_it); +int read_buf_from_file(unsigned char *buf, unsigned long size, const char *filename); +int write_buf_to_file(unsigned char *buf, unsigned long size, const char *filename); #define OK 0 #define NT 1 /* Not tested */ |